+* DefaultEnabled: The default value is 'yes' which means that apt will
|
|
|
+ try to acquire this target from all sources. If set to 'no' the user
|
|
|
+ has to explicitly enable this target in the sources.list file with the
|
|
|
+ Targets option(s) – or override this value in a config file.
|
|
|
+* Optional: The default value is 'yes' and should be kept at this value.
|
|
|
+ If enabled the acquire system will skip the download if the file isn't
|
|
|
+ mentioned in the Release file. Otherwise this is treated as a hard
|
|
|
+ error and the update process fails. Note that failures while
|
|
|
downloading (e.g. 404 or hash verification errors) are failures,
|
|
|
regardless of this setting.

+# Acquiring files to a specific location on disk
|
|
|
+
|
|
|
+You can't by design to avoid multiple frontends requesting the same file
|
|
|
+to be downloaded to multiple different places on (different) disks
|
|
|
+(among other reasons). See the next point for a solution if you really
|
|
|
+have to force a specific location by creating symlinks.
|
|
|
+
|
|
|
+# Post processing the acquired files
|
|
|
+
|
|
|
+You can't modify the files apt has downloaded as apt keeps state with
|
|
|
+e.g. the modification times of the files and advanced features like
|
|
|
+PDiffs break.
|
|
|
+
|
|
|
+You can however install an APT::Update::Post-Invoke{-Success,} hook
|
|
|
+script and use them to copy (modified) files to a different location.
|
|
|
+Use 'apt-get indextargets' (or similar) to get the filenames – do not
|
|
|
+look into /var/lib/apt/lists directly!
|
|
|
+
|
|
|
+Please avoid time consuming calculations in the scripts and instead just
|
|
|
+trigger a background task as there is little to no feedback for the user
|
|
|
+while hook scripts run.
